Andrew Miller Headed To DL
Andrew Miller Headed To DL
Andrew Miller Headed To DL
Yankees closer Andrew Miller is headed to the Disabled List with an injury to a muscle in his forearm. Manager Joe Girardi says Miller " had been experiencing it before" but it hadn't been an issue.

Future Closer?
Future Closer?
Future Closer?
Current Yankees closer David Robertson will be a highly sought after free agent this off-season, which is bringing up the question as to whether or not middle reliever and rookie sensation Dellin Betances will be ready to step into the closing role after one season.
